<p>Join the team as Twilio’s next Staff Product Manager for the Channels Data team.</p>
<p><strong>About the job</strong></p>
<p>The Channels Data team is continuously identifying strategic opportunities for platform maturity and improved customer logs and analytics experiences for Twilio’s Email and Messaging channels. This product manager would help lead, organize and execute our channel data bulk egress strategy through webhooks and other scaled data exhaust product recommendations. This is a platform product role with very little front end or application side feature development.</p>
